Handover Note — Franchise Agreement, Calder Grove Region

With my move to the Northfield division, Marta Vellin assumes oversight of the Brindlehouse Bakeries franchise agreement. Renewal terms were agreed in principle last month; legal review is pending. Royalty schedules and territory maps are filed in the shared directors' folder. Before circulating anything further, heads of department should note the following.

board note of hafog-kafop: Only 50 of the 505 pilot accounts renewed Eliys, so a churn review is set for April 7. Fravanox Partners is in early talks to buy Tamvanix Logistics for about $273.9 million.

Routing itself is fine — the resolver correctly maps marketing links to the onboarding flow — but we cannot verify the payments deep-link path until the vault is reopened. Future maintainers: do not retry unseal blindly; it extends the lockout. Per the escalation runbook, the recovery passphrase for the staging vault is recorded immediately below this line.

vault phrase of tajep-kagef = istwyn-wendor-jorius

# Build Provenance: LiftSim Dispatch Simulator

All LiftSim builds are produced on the Harrowgate build farm from signed commits to the mainline branch. Plugin authors targeting the dispatch API should verify that their test harness matches an officially provenanced build; unofficial forks are not supported. Each release archive embeds a manifest listing the compiler version, dependency lockfile digest, and the dispatch-rule corpus revision. When filing compatibility reports, always quote the token printed below the manifest header.

build token for tawip-yageg: htk9_92ac43d42